Tiger Ramudu is a classic Telugu film released in 1962, featuring the legendary actor N.T. Rama Rao (NTR) in the titular role. The movie showcases NTR's charismatic presence and remarkable acting prowess, along with the talents of Rajasulochana and Ammaji, creating a dynamic ensemble that captivates audiences.
